Tuesday, Jan 15: A night of very special barrel aged beers. I have been
saving for this one for a while. We will have some amazing beers on tap -
Allagash Curiuex (bourbon barrel aged Tripel), Sierra Nevada bourbon
barrel aged Stout, Alpine Ichabod sour brown ale, Russian River Toronado
20th Anniversary Ale, Moonlight 60 to Life Toronado Anniversary Ale and we
will have two brand new beers to debut – Rodenbach and Lost Abbey Vertias
003 (a blend of barrel aged beers in cluding Angel.s Share and Cuvee de
Tomme). I will also have some very special bottled beers for this night -
Lost Abbey Angel.s Share, Firestone 11, Port Brewing Older Viscosity,
Rodenbach and Rodenbach Grand Gru.

Wednesday, Jan 16: I imagine that most of the barrel aged beers will still
be on tap this night. But just for good measure we will have some beers
from San Diego Brewing Company brewer Dean Rouleau including a cask of the
fantastic Hopnotic IPA at 5 pm. We also will have the last keg of Dean.s
Hop Diego Belgian-style IPA on tap.

Thursday, Jan 17: This is Exponential Hoppiness night. We will have this
incredible beer from Alpine on tap and on cask. The cask will tap at 5 pm
and the keg will be on by 6 pm. So double your pleasure, double your
Hoppiness. Of course the regular Pure Hoppiness will be on tap as well,
and room allowing, the O.Brien.s IPA

Friday, Jan 18: Is there any other way to end an O.Brien.s celebration
week than a night of big hoppy double IPAs? We have some new ones like
Victory Hop Wallop and Moylan.s Moylander along with lots of old favorites
like Bear Republic Racer X, Pizza Port Carlsbad Poor Man.s, Ballast Point
Sculpin IPA and of course Pliny and Pure Hoppiness. I guarantee that
Friday night.s line up will not disappoint.

Saturday, Jan 19: We will continue the celebration by tapping any kegs
that couldn.t make it on during the week, so look for even more special
beers all weekend. I have a few late arriving Belgian Christmas ales (Nice
Chouffe, St. Feullien) that I am going to try and tap over the weekend.
